The density profile and the wavelength dependence of compact radio source size

Astrophysics 2007-05-23 v1

Abstract

In the gaseous disk model, the density profile is derived from the mass and energy conservation in the gravitational field of a central energy source. Using the condition for emission, following from the induced character of radiation process, we obtain the wavelength dependence of radio source size which is consistent with observational data.
